中子俘获疗法治疗的人类黑色素瘤覆盖皮肤中吸收剂量的估算。

Estimation of absorbed dose in the covering skin of human melanoma treated by neutron capture therapy.

Abstract

A patient with malignant melanoma was treated by thermal neutron capture therapy using 10B-paraboronophenylalanine. The compound was injected subcutaneously into ten locations in the tumor-surrounding skin, and the patient was then irradiated with thermal neutrons from the Musashi Reactor at reactor power of 100 KW and neutron flux of 1.2 X 10(9) n/cm2/s. Total absorbed dose to the skin was 11.7-12.5 Gy in the radiation field. The dose equivalents of these doses were estimated as 21.5 and 24.4 Sv, respectively. Early skin reaction after irradiation was checked from day 1 to day 60. The maximum and mean skin scores were 2.0 and 1.5, respectively, and the therapy was safely completed as far as skin reaction was concerned. Some factors influencing the absorbed dose and dose equivalent to the skin are discussed.

摘要

一名恶性黑色素瘤患者接受了使用10B-对硼苯丙氨酸的热中子俘获疗法。将该化合物皮下注射到肿瘤周围皮肤的十个部位,然后患者接受来自武藏反应堆的热中子照射,反应堆功率为100千瓦,中子通量为1.2×10(9) n/cm2/s。辐射野中皮肤的总吸收剂量为11.7-12.5 Gy。这些剂量的剂量当量估计分别为21.5和24.4 Sv。在照射后的第1天至第60天检查早期皮肤反应。最大和平均皮肤评分分别为2.0和1.5,就皮肤反应而言,治疗安全完成。讨论了一些影响皮肤吸收剂量和剂量当量的因素。
